Turn a one-off message into a reusable template
Use when you keep writing similar messages and want a fill-in-the-blank template to save time.
Turn this message into a reusable template I can use again.
A real example of the message I keep writing:
{{example_message}}
The situations I send it in: {{use_cases}}
Do this:
1. Strip out the one-off specifics and replace them with clearly marked placeholders like [name] or [date].
2. Keep the parts that stay the same every time.
3. Add short bracketed notes where I might want to adjust tone or add detail.
4. Provide one or two variants for common situations if useful.
5. List the placeholders at the end so I know what to fill in.
Keep the wording natural so it never reads like a form letter.Click the copy button in the top right of the block to grab the full prompt.
